我有一个正在使用 SublimeText 2 编辑的 .sql 文件。该文件用于将数据插入数据库以进行测试。我正在尝试调整空白,以便更轻松地动态更改数据。当光标位于“0”和逗号 (,) 之间时尝试使用 Tab 时,Sublime 2 会将“0”更改为日期。
例子:
INSERT INTO `Table_Name`
(`ID` , `First` , `Last` , `IsAdmin`, `JoinDate`)
VALUES
(`999` , `John` , `Smith` , 0, 2013-05-09);
我然后 Tab:
INSERT INTO `Table_Name`
(`ID` , `First` , `Last` , `IsAdmin`, `JoinDate`)
VALUES
(`999` , `John` , `Smith` , 2013-05-09, 2013-05-09);
我在 Sublime 中做错了什么或者这只是一个错误?
最佳答案
这只是在当前项目中找到的与 0
SublimeText 最接近的匹配项。 ST 会跟踪您在项目中浏览的所有文件中突出显示的几乎所有符号/文本/数字,并将它们用于自动完成。
以我为例,写入 0
并按 Tab 自动完成为 00148800
,因为在我打开的文件中,有这一行我突出显示 -
"salt": "0.00148800 1367514464",
在你的情况下,你之前写过2013-05-09
。因此这个。
您可以 turn this off , 或者直接按空格键。
关于mysql - 标签时 Sublime Text 2 将 0 更改为日期,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/16451501/